    RLC 1040/1080 maker?

    I was noticing that the power centers made by rotel have an APC sticker or label on them below the LCD window. I also know that there is an international company called APC that specifically makes electrical power centers/conditioners, cables, swiches, etc. for the home and for industrial purposes. Is there any conection between the two companies?? In other words, does APC make the units for Rotel? Not that it really makes a difference to me - I just am curious and want a 1040 unit. APC looks like a very reputible company.

    The Rotel units are indeed rebadged APC units with a modified to match Rotel, design motif. It's pretty common knowledge and is, I believe, even mentioned in Rotel's literature on them. APC is indeed a VERY reputable company and was a wise choice for Rotel to team with IMO
